Oishi Brewery Company

Oishi Brewery Company

Kyoto

Founded during the Genroku era (1688-1704), our brewery has been crafting sake using traditional methods passed down by experienced brewers from the Tanba region. The sake is made with Tanba rice, which benefits from the region’s favorable climate and natural environment, and water from the Hosu River’s underground springs. We offer a diverse range of sake, including sweet and dry varieties, as well as options for chilled or warmed sake.
